Description Conrad Kostecki gentoo-dev 2022-04-27 20:18:11 UTC
Compilation of media-libs/imlib2-1.9.0[eps] will fail with ABI_X86="32 64", as it reports: configure: error: PS support was requested but system does not support it

The problem is, that the dependency app-text/libspectre is a non multilib depedency, which does not support ABI_X86="32 64".
